CVE-2021-3540: Ivanti MobileIron Core clish Restricted Shell Escape via Argument Injection

By abusing the 'install rpm info detail' command, an attacker can escape the restricted clish shell on affected versions of Ivanti MobileIron Core. This issue was fixed in version 11.1.0.0.

Technical view

The issue is CWE-88 argument injection in the MobileIron Core clish command 'install rpm info detail'. A network-reachable attacker with high privileges can break out of the restricted shell. CVSS 3.1 is 6.5 with high confidentiality and integrity impact, no availability impact, and high privileges required.

Likely exposure

Exposure is limited to Ivanti MobileIron Core versions 10.7.0.1-9 and 11.0.0.1-3. Systems at 11.1.0.0 or later are described as fixed. The source bundle provides no CPEs or broader affected product list.

Mitigation direction

  • Upgrade Ivanti MobileIron Core to version 11.1.0.0 or later.
  • Restrict administrative access to trusted networks and named administrators.
  • Review vendor guidance for any newer advisories or supported upgrade paths.
  • Remove or disable unused privileged accounts where operationally possible.

Validation and detection

  • Inventory MobileIron Core instances and record exact software versions.
  • Confirm no instance runs versions 10.7.0.1-9 or 11.0.0.1-3.
  • Review who has high-privilege clish access on affected systems.
  • Check administrative logs for unexpected use of clish package-inspection functions.
